Plant characteristics associated with widespread variation in eelgrass wasting disease

Abstract: Seagrasses are ecosystem engineers of essential marine habitat. Their populations are rapidly declining worldwide. One potential cause of seagrass population declines is wasting disease, which is caused by opportunistic pathogens in the genus Labyrinthula. While infection with these pathogens is common in seagrasses, theory suggests that disease only occurs when environmental stressors cause immunosuppression of the host. “…To our knowledge, few other re gions have shown equally high prevalence of lesions in Z. marina during recent years. Lesion prevalence has previously been found to vary be tween 0 and 95% (x -= 23%) in Z. marina meadows in northern Europe (Bockelmann et al 2013), and between 6 and 79% (x -= 44%) in the San Juan archipelago, USA (Groner et al 2014(Groner et al , 2016. The prevalence of L. zosterae cells in Z. marina is also higher in our study compared to the few areas where this has previously been measured.…”

“…No significant difference in L. zosterae infection was found between the 3 high-salinity meadows, but a significant small-scale variation among shoots within meadows was detected. Overall, our results show that high-salinity meadows of Z. marina from the study area have high prevalence of L. zosterae infection compared to what has been reported from other regions (Bockelmann et al 2013, Groner et al 2016. We found that 87 to 100% of the shoots had lesions and that 61 to 91% carried L. zosterae cells.…”
